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- $scope.login = function(acc) {
- console.log(acc);//getting data input by user
- //post is used to create
- $http.post('php/login.php', {'user': $scope.acc.user, 'pass': $scope.acc.pass}).success(function(data) {
- console.log(data);
- if (data) {//row inserted
- // if not successful, bind errors to error variables
- console.log("Succesful");
- $scope.insertMessage = "Data inserted";
- } else {
- // if unsuccessful, bind success message to message
- $scope.insertMessage = "Data not inserted";
- }
- $scope.acc="";//reset values in form to empty
- //redirect to list
- });
- $http.get('php/login.php').success(function(logged){
- $scope.loggedin = logged;
- console.log($scope.loggedin);
- })
- .error(function(err){
- $log.error(err);
- });
- };
- <?php
- $data = json_decode(file_get_contents("php://input"));
- $user = $data->user;
- $pass = $data->pass;
- require_once("connection.php");
- $conn = connectToDb();
- $query= "SELECT count(*)
- FROM tbl_logdetails
- WHERE username = '$user' and password = '$pass'";
- $result = mysqli_query($conn, $query)
- or die("error in query: ".mysqli_error($conn));
- $row = mysqli_fetch_row($result);
- $count = $row[0];
- echo $count;
- if($count == 0){
- $logged = false;
- }else{
- $logged=true;
- }
- echo json_encode($logged);
- ?>
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ement